Abstract

The present invention is directed to a front light extraction tape for coupling light out of a light guiding device. The tape has a flexible, light transmissive outer portion and a light coupling element secured to a lower surface of the outer portion without using adhesive. An input surface of the light coupling element is contactable with an output surface of the light guiding device for receiving light therefrom. A reflecting surface of the light coupling element is aligned so as to reflect light received into the light coupling element through the light transmissive outer portion. The light coupling element may be formed integrally with the outer portion so as to avoid a material interface between the light coupling element and the outer portion.
